On Friday, June 17, 2016, the Mid Mon Valley All Sports Hall of Fame honored area senior scholar athletes during its 23rd annual induction banquet at The Willow Room in Rostraver Township. Honoring the Mon Valley’s best and brightest in sports and in the classroom has been an integral part of the Sports Hall of Fame since 1995.

Area students are selected by Mon Valley athletic directors and high school principals and are recognized at the banquet for their academic and athletic accomplishments. The Sports Hall of Fame Committee awards a certificate of merit reflecting personal dedication to achieving the highest standards of excellence as a scholar and in sportsmanship.

 Raymond Sitton and Maris Seto received individual achievement awards for track and field.Mid Mon Valley All Sports Hall of Fame Names Mon Valley WPIAL Achievement Awardees

Belle Vernon Area’s head wrestling coach, Mike Doppleheuer, and senior co-captain Mitchell Hartman, accept, on behalf of their team, the Class AAA WPIAL championship wrestling Belle Vernon Area Leopards Achievement Award. Randy Marino and Steve Russell of the Hall of Fame presented the awards.

Individual WPIAL championship BVA wrestling achievement awardees include senior Derek Verkleeren, 152 pounds, and sophomore Zachary Hartman, 132 pounds, with the presentation done by Randy Marino and Steve Russell.

Track and field individual WPIAL champion Raymond Sitton, 110m hurdles, of Monessen, and Maris Seto, high jump, of Brownsville, received the Hall of Fame Achievement award from Randy Marino.
